30 Common IT Consultant Interview Questions and Answers

30 Common IT Consultant Interview Questions and Answers

Here’s a list of 30 common IT Consultant interview questions along with example answers and explanations:

Technical Skills

What programming languages are you proficient in?

Answer: “I am proficient in Python, Java, and SQL. For instance, I used Python to develop an automated reporting tool that reduced manual reporting time by 50%.”

Describe a challenging technical problem you solved.

Answer: “I encountered a database performance issue. By analyzing query performance and indexing strategies, I optimized queries, resulting in a 30% speed increase.”

How do you stay updated on technology trends?

Answer: “I subscribe to tech blogs, attend webinars, and participate in local tech meetups to stay informed about emerging technologies.”

Explain the difference between Agile and Waterfall methodologies.

Answer: “Agile is iterative and allows for flexibility, while Waterfall is sequential and structured. I prefer Agile for projects needing adaptability.”

What experience do you have with cloud services?

Answer: “I have extensive experience with AWS and Azure, where I migrated applications to the cloud, optimizing costs and improving scalability.”

Problem-Solving and Project Management

Describe a project where you managed a team.

Answer: “I led a team to implement a new CRM system. By assigning roles based on strengths and maintaining open communication, we completed the project two weeks ahead of schedule.”

How do you handle tight deadlines?

Answer: “I prioritize tasks based on urgency and impact. For example, during a recent project, I used a project management tool to streamline workflow and meet a tight deadline.”

Give an example of how you dealt with a difficult stakeholder.

Answer: “I had a stakeholder resistant to change. By actively listening to their concerns and demonstrating the benefits of the new system, I gained their support.”

How do you approach risk management?

Answer: “I conduct a risk assessment at the start of a project, identifying potential risks and developing mitigation strategies. For example, in a recent project, we identified data security risks and implemented additional encryption.”

Describe your experience with change management.

Answer: “I developed a change management plan for a software update, including training sessions and support materials, which helped users transition smoothly.”

Client Interaction and Communication

How do you assess a client’s needs?

Answer: “I conduct thorough interviews and surveys to gather requirements, followed by a gap analysis to identify areas for improvement.”

Describe a time you had to explain a technical concept to a non-technical client.

Answer: “I explained the benefits of cloud storage to a client by using analogies related to physical storage, making it relatable and easier to understand.”

How do you manage client expectations?

Answer: “I ensure clear communication about project timelines and deliverables, providing regular updates to keep clients informed.”

What is your approach to client feedback?

Answer: “I view feedback as an opportunity for improvement. After implementing a project, I gather feedback through surveys and adjust our approach accordingly.”

How do you handle conflicts within a project team?

Answer: “I facilitate open discussions to address conflicts, focusing on the issue rather than personal differences, fostering a collaborative environment.”

Behavioral Questions

What motivates you as an IT consultant?

Answer: “I’m motivated by problem-solving and helping clients achieve their goals. Seeing the positive impact of my work drives me.”

Describe a situation where you took the initiative.

Answer: “I proposed a new project management tool to streamline processes, resulting in improved team efficiency and communication.”

How do you handle failure?

Answer: “I analyze what went wrong and learn from it. After a project didn’t meet its objectives, I gathered feedback and adjusted our approach for future projects.”

What is your greatest professional achievement?

Answer: “My greatest achievement was leading a project that increased client satisfaction scores by 40% through improved service delivery.”

How do you prioritize your work?

Answer: “I use a priority matrix to classify tasks based on urgency and importance, ensuring I focus on high-impact activities.”

Scenario-Based Questions

How would you handle a project that is falling behind schedule?

Answer: “I would analyze the causes of the delay, reallocate resources, and communicate transparently with stakeholders about the new timeline.”

If a client requests a feature that is not feasible, how would you respond?

Answer: “I would explain the technical limitations and offer alternative solutions that align with their goals.”

What would you do if you disagreed with a team member’s approach?

Answer: “I would discuss our differing viewpoints openly, weighing the pros and cons of each approach to find the best solution.”

How do you ensure quality in your deliverables?

Answer: “I implement quality assurance processes, including code reviews and testing, to ensure deliverables meet established standards.”

What steps would you take to onboard a new client?

Answer: “I would start with a kickoff meeting to understand their goals, followed by regular check-ins to align expectations and progress.”

General Questions

Where do you see yourself in five years?

Answer: “I see myself in a leadership role, guiding teams to deliver innovative IT solutions that drive business success.”

What do you think is the most important skill for an IT consultant?

Answer: “Strong communication skills are crucial, as they help bridge the gap between technical teams and clients.”

How do you ensure you meet project deadlines?

Answer: “I set clear milestones and use project management tools to track progress, allowing for timely adjustments if needed.”

What is your experience with data analysis?

Answer: “I’ve used tools like Excel and Tableau to analyze data trends, providing insights that informed strategic decisions for clients.”

Why should we hire you?

Answer: “I bring a unique combination of technical expertise, problem-solving skills, and a strong client-focused approach that can drive project success.”

Conclusion

These questions and answers should help you prepare for an IT Consultant interview by providing insights into common expectations and showcasing your skills effectively. Tailor your responses to reflect your own experiences and achievements

 

Prepmaster Staff

Add comment

Follow us

Don't be shy, get in touch. We love meeting interesting people and making new friends.